Basic Ice Cream Base Recipe and Measurements
Making delicious no-churn ice cream in glass jars starts with the right base recipe. The secret to homemade ice cream is choosing the best ingredients and measuring them just right.
For a basic no-churn ice cream, you need just a few simple ingredients. These ingredients mix together to create a creamy, tasty dessert. Knowing how each ingredient affects the final taste and texture is key.
Core Ingredients Breakdown
Here’s what you’ll need for a classic no-churn ice cream base:
- Heavy Cream (1/2 cup): Provides rich, smooth texture
- Sweetened Condensed Milk (2 Tbsp): Adds sweetness and prevents ice crystals
- Whole Milk (2 Tbsp): Helps create a softer consistency
- Pure Vanilla Extract (1 tsp): Delivers classic flavor
Proper Ingredient Temperature Guidelines
Temperature is key for smooth glass jar treats. Cold ingredients prevent separation and ensure a smooth texture. Always use chilled cream and milk for the best results.

Step-by-Step Shaking Technique for Creamy Texture
Making Mason jar ice cream is easy with the right shaking technique. It turns simple ingredients into creamy treats. The trick is to shake just right for a smooth texture.
Ready to make ice cream? Here’s how to start:
- Seal your mason jar tightly with a secure lid
- Hold the jar firmly with both hands
- Begin shaking with consistent, rhythmic motions
- Maintain a steady shaking pace for 3-4 minutes
The secret is in the rhythm and duration of your shake. Shake in a steady motion to mix and freeze the ingredients. Look for these signs as you shake:
- Mixture begins to thicken
- Texture becomes creamy and smooth
- Mixture holds its shape when drizzled

Chocolate and Strawberry Variations
Turn your basic ball jar desserts into tasty chocolate and strawberry treats. Just add a few simple ingredients. These changes will make your homemade ice cream a hit with everyone.
Chocolate Mason Jar Ice Cream
Making a rich chocolate version of your desserts is simple. Start with your usual ice cream base. Then, add these important ingredients:
- 1 tablespoon Dutch-processed cocoa powder
- Optional: 1 teaspoon vanilla extract for depth
- Extra pinch of salt to enhance chocolate flavor
When adding cocoa powder, sift it well to avoid clumps. Whisk it in thoroughly to mix it smoothly into your cream.
Strawberry Mason Jar Ice Cream
For a fruity twist, strawberry is a top choice. You can add strawberry flavor in two ways:
- Fresh Strawberry Method:
- 2 tablespoons finely chopped fresh strawberries
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- Quick cook strawberries to break down fibers
- Jam Method:
- 2 tablespoons high-quality strawberry jam
- Strain jam for smoother texture if desired

Proper Freezing Time and Storage Tips
Making perfect no-churn ice cream in glass jars needs careful freezing and storage. Your homemade treat must get the right attention to get that creamy texture everyone adores.
The best way to freeze your mason jar ice cream is by following these steps:
- Freeze for 4-6 hours at a consistent temperature
- Rotate the jar every hour to prevent ingredient separation
- Maintain a freezer temperature of 0°F (-18°C)
Here are important tips for storing your glass jar treats:
| Storage Method | Recommended Duration | Quality Preservation |
|---|---|---|
| Sealed Mason Jar | Up to 2 weeks | Excellent |
| Plastic Wrap Cover | 5-7 days | Good |
| Exposed in Freezer | 3-4 days | Fair |
For the best taste, let your no-churn ice cream sit at room temperature for 5-10 minutes before serving. This makes it easier to scoop and keeps it creamy.
Pro tip: If you’re storing your treats for over a week, cover the ice cream with plastic wrap. This stops ice crystals from forming.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
Making easy summer desserts like Mason jar ice cream can be tricky. Learning how to fix texture problems is crucial. This way, you can make the creamiest frozen treats in your kitchen.
When you make homemade ice cream, you might face some common issues. Knowing how to solve these problems will help you get smooth, tasty results every time.
Solving Texture Challenges
Texture problems often come from wrong ingredient handling or mixing. Here are some solutions to common Mason jar ice cream issues:
- Grainy texture: Make sure ingredients are fully dissolved before shaking
- Icy consistency: Use heavy cream with high fat content
- Soft serve-like result: Adjust freezing time and technique
Preventing Ice Crystal Formation
Ice crystals can mess up the smooth texture of your frozen treats. Here are some tips to reduce crystal formation:
| Problem | Solution |
|---|---|
| Large ice crystals | Shake mixture thoroughly, use fine sugar |
| Uneven freezing | Store at consistent temperature, avoid repeated thawing |
| Moisture separation | Use stabilizers like cornstarch or egg yolks |
